Redbird Report Podcast

Redbird Report Podcast – Who’s In & Who’s Out? – July 17th, 2023

– Cardinals making moves

– Cabrera out / Tepera in

– Mo on what fans should expect at the deadline

– Who’s in and who’s out?

– Pending free agents that could be dealt

– Will the Cardinals loosen up the outfield logjam?

– Who would you trade: Donovan or Edman?

Learn more about your ad choices. Visit